Terry,
It is reminding you that you have a chance to save if you want before
exiting and losing the chance forever.  If you had it set to save text,
or both text and pictures, there would be no need to prompt you for
that, but you would fill your storage card faster than you might want.
It says that you can either press f4 to shut down, f2 to save and
something else that I do not now recall.
